🌡️🧪 Investigating Temperature Changes When Salt Dissolves in Water

24/07/2026

Our Year 9 students carried out a chemistry practical to investigate how temperature changes occur when different salts dissolve in water.


During the experiment, students measured the temperature of the solution before and after dissolving various salts. By carefully recording and comparing their results, they identified whether each reaction was exothermic (releasing heat) or endothermic (absorbing heat).


This practical investigation helped students understand how energy is transferred during chemical changes and how temperature measurements can be used to classify different types of reactions. It also strengthened their skills in scientific observation, accurate data collection, analysis, and experimental techniques.


A valuable hands-on learning experience that deepened students’ understanding of chemical reactions, energy changes, and the principles of thermochemistry. 🌡️⚗️✨
